Just a little question. I usually work for hours with finale 2005, and my eyes hurts me a lot.
Is it possible to change the page color in the edit window to have less brightness? (I'd like to work on a grey page instead of a white one)
My screen brightness is already set to the lowest level. . I only noticed it is possible to change the background color.
Please, does anyone know?

I realize that in 2005, you can only change the background color, not the paper color itself, a thing that is now possible in version 2007 and later (I don't have 2006 to check it) : Program options -> Palettes and backgrounds -> Manuscript texture :
Either chose a graphic file or use the "solid color" button to use a plain colour background.
I personally chose a light green background solid color, easy on the eyes.
